The Annual General Meeting (AGM) of the RSS CSML will take place on 2 December, 12:00โ13:00 (UK time) via Zoom. The meeting is open to all and will review the sectionโs activities from the past year, outline plans for the year ahead, and present the committee for 2026.

We are inviting applications for the Chapman Fellowship inย Statistics at Imperial College London.
This is a kind of super-postdoc: 3 years contract, excellent working conditions, and candidates are expected to propose an independent research plan.

๐จ New paper: โTowards Adaptive Self-Normalized ISโ, @ IEEE Statistical Signal Processing Workshop.
TLDR;
To estimate ยต = E_p[f(ฮธ)] with SNIS, instead of doing MCMC on p(ฮธ) or learning a parametric q(ฮธ), we try MCMC directly on p(ฮธ)| f(ฮธ)-ยต | (variance-minimizing proposal).
